  • #23
    Oct 16, 2025 · 25 min

    Pt.2 Beyond Phishing: Cyber Threats in the Age of AI with Four Flynn

    In part two, Hannah and Four tackle the human element at the heart of cybersecurity: Who are the bad actors, and what motivates them? They dissect the evolving strategies designed to stop social engineering attacks - like passkeys and risk-based authentication - and confront the complex security and privacy challenges that may be introduced by autonomous agents.

  • #16
    May 8, 2025 · 36 min

    AI and the Future of Health with Joelle Barral

    In this episode, Professor Hannah Fry interviews Joelle Barral, Senior Director of Research at Google DeepMind, about AI in healthcare. They discuss existing AI applications including image analysis for diabetic retinopathy and the expansion of diagnostic tools as a result of multi-modal models. The conversation highlights AI's potential to improve healthcare delivery, personalize treatment, expand access worldwide, and ultimately, bring back the joy of practicing medicine.

  • #15
    Apr 24, 2025 · 40 min

    Consciousness, Reasoning and the Philosophy of AI with Murray Shanahan

    In this episode, Hannah is once again joined by Murray Shanahan, Professor of Cognitive Robotics at Imperial College London and Principal Scientist at Google DeepMind, for a philosophical deep dive on AI. They explore everything from consciousness and metacognition in animals, to symbolic AI and neural networks. Murray also shares insights into his involvement with the film 'Ex Machina' and discusses the idea of reasoning, anthropomorphism, and the future of AI.
